Srinagar: Burglars broke into the revered shrine of Rehbab Sahib (RA) in Aali Kadal locality of Srinagar and decamped with cash, the second such incident in the past two weeks in the city.

Official sources said that burglars struck at the shrine last night. They broke down the iron box and decamped with the cash.

Locals said that they were shocked the moment they found cash from the donation box at Rahbab Sahab (RA) shrine looted by burglars. However, it could not be ascertained as to how much cash was in the donation box that was looted.

On September 12, burglars decamped with cash from the shrine of Hazrat Sheikh Abdul Qadir Jeelani (RA) in Khanyar area of the city.

Meanwhile, the residents expressed shock over the incident and appealed to the police to take stringent action against the culprits.

A police official said they have taken cognisance of the incident.
